What is the Emergency Proxy Vote Application?
The Emergency Proxy Vote Application is a crucial form in the UK's voting process, allowing individuals unable to vote in person due to emergencies to appoint a proxy. This is particularly significant for situations arising from medical emergencies and other unforeseen circumstances. Properly appointing a proxy requires timely submission of the application to ensure that voter rights are protected.

Who is eligible to use the Emergency Proxy Vote Application?
This form is intended for UK residents facing medical emergencies that prevent them from voting in person. It allows them to appoint a proxy to ensure their votes are still counted.
What is the deadline for submitting the proxy vote application?
The completed Emergency Proxy Vote Application must be submitted to your local electoral registration office before election day. Ensure to check specific deadlines as they may vary by election.
How do I submit the Emergency Proxy Vote Application?
You can submit the application by sending it to your local electoral registration office. This can typically be done by mail or via electronic submission using platforms like pdfFiller.
Are any supporting documents required with the proxy vote application?
While no specific supporting documentation is typically required for the Emergency Proxy Vote Application, you may need to provide evidence of your medical emergency to validate your request.
What are some common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include missing required fields, providing inaccurate information, or failing to gather necessary details about the proxy. Always double-check for completeness before submission.
How long does processing take for the Emergency Proxy Vote Application?
Processing times can vary depending on the local electoral office, but it’s advisable to submit your application as early as possible to avoid any delays, especially close to election dates.
Can I withdraw or change my proxy after submitting the application?
Yes, you can withdraw or change your proxy vote arrangement. However, it’s essential to do this formally through your electoral registration office ahead of the election day to ensure your vote is counted correctly.
